This week's theater

Thoroughly Modern Millie - The Naples Players present highspirited, toe-tapping musical suitable for all ages in "Thoroughly Modern Millie," performed through July 25 on the main stage at Sugden Community Theatre, 701 5th Avenue South, Naples. Tickets: $30/adults, $10/students. Dinner show package available. 263-7990 or www.naplesplayers.org.

Mulan - Broadway Palm Children's Theater performs Disney's "Mulan Jr." July 2, 3, 10, 12, 17, 18, 24, 26, 30, 31; and Aug. 2. Travel back to the legendary, story-telling days of ancient China with this action-packed stage adaptation of Disney's "Mulan." 278-4422 or www. BroadwayPalm.com.

Peter Pan - Broadway Palm Dinner Theatre presents the high-flying adventure "Peter Pan" through Aug. 8. Performances are Wednesday through Sunday evenings with selected matinees. 278-4422 or www.BroadwayPalm. com.

Where the Girls Are - Sanibel Island's Schoolhouse Theater presents the high-energy musical review "Where the Girls Are" through Aug. 15. 472-6862 or theschoolhousetheater. com.

That's Entertainment - Sanibel Island's Schoolhouse Theater presents "Now That's Entertainment," a musical tribute to the songs the songs we know and love at 7 p.m. Wednesdays and Saturdays through Aug. 15. 472-6862 or theschoolhousetheater. com.
